Abstract
A detector detects the variation of resistance between fingers of a human's hands which varies in response to his mental condition. When the mental condition is varied and the resistance between fingers is changed, the detector detects such resistance variation, which is then converted into an electric signal. This electric signal drive light emitting diodes (LEDs) or the like so that the user of this detector can realize his mental condition by watching the light. By further providing a lamp, an image film and a lens, the user can watch the image on the image film when light radiated from the lamp projects such image onto the lens. This detector is useful for meditation and mental training because the user can realize the variation of his mental condition by watching the light or image.
